Output d3ae3445a92a588d44a57646484b4026131bf9873d4f1504086317222670667a:1

value
2151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25db7f982a5feefda667feb1a908159f9c084f8b OP_EQUAL
address
359BsfALUyV3Tq91V6EJgMS2tJsArqNh6u
transaction
d3ae3445a92a588d44a57646484b4026131bf9873d4f1504086317222670667a
spent
true